The standard size of a UK pallet is 1200mm x 1000mm, corresponding to the European Pallet Association (EPAL) specifications This size is widely used in the UK and across Europe, making it easy to transport goods between countries The height of a standard UK pallet is typically around 144mm, although there are variations in height depending on the type of goods being transported.
Another common size of a UK pallet is the Euro pallet, which measures 800mm x 1200mm This size is also widely used in the UK and across Europe, especially in industries such as retail and manufacturing The height of a Euro pallet is usually around 144mm, similar to a standard UK pallet.
In addition to the standard and Euro pallet sizes, there are also other sizes of UK pallets available, such as the half pallet and quarter pallet These smaller sizes are often used for lighter or smaller goods, or when space is limited The half pallet measures 600mm x 800mm, while the quarter pallet measures 400mm x 600mm.

When it comes to the height of a UK pallet, there are also variations depending on the type of goods being transported Standard UK pallets have a height of 144mm, but there are also low-height pallets available that measure around 78mm in height Low-height pallets are commonly used in industries where space is limited, such as warehousing and retail.
The weight capacity of a UK pallet also varies depending on its size and construction Standard UK pallets can typically hold a weight of up to 1000kg, while Euro pallets have a slightly lower weight capacity of around 800kg Oversize pallets have a higher weight capacity, often able to hold up to 1500kg or more.
In addition to the size and weight capacity of UK pallets, it is also important to consider the type of material used in their construction Most UK pallets are made from wood, which is durable and sturdy enough to withstand the rigors of transportation and storage However, there are also plastic pallets available, which are lightweight and resistant to water and chemicals.
